SES_DOWNLOAD_MICROCODE_STATUS_DIAGNOSTIC_PAGE-Struktur (scsi.h)
Die Diagnoseseite "Microcodestatus herunterladen" enthält Informationen über die status eines oder mehrerer Microcode-Downloadvorgänge.
Syntax
typedef struct _SES_DOWNLOAD_MICROCODE_STATUS_DIAGNOSTIC_PAGE {
UCHAR PageCode;
UCHAR NumberOfSecondarySubEnclosures;
UCHAR PageLength[2];
UCHAR GenerationCode[4];
SES_DOWNLOAD_MICROCODE_STATUS_DESCRIPTOR Descriptors[ANYSIZE_ARRAY];
} SES_DOWNLOAD_MICROCODE_STATUS_DIAGNOSTIC_PAGE, *PSES_DOWNLOAD_MICROCODE_STATUS_DIAGNOSTIC_PAGE;
Member
PageCode
Gibt die Diagnoseseite an, die gesendet oder angefordert wird. . Der Wert ist 0x0E.
NumberOfSecondarySubEnclosures
Gibt die Anzahl der Download-Microcode-status-Deskriptoren in Deskriptoren an, ohne die primäre SES_DOWNLOAD_MICROCODE_STATUS_DESCRIPTOR. Dieser Wert muss auf denselben Wert wie das Feld NumberOfSecondarySubEnclosures in der SES_CONFIGURATION_DIAGNOSTIC_PAGE-Struktur festgelegt werden.
PageLength[2]
Gibt die Anzahl der Bytes an, die auf der Diagnoseseite folgen.
GenerationCode[4]
Gibt den Wert des Generierungscodes an.
Descriptors[ANYSIZE_ARRAY]
Enthält eine SES_DOWNLOAD_MICROCODE_STATUS_DESCRIPTOR für jeden Download-Microcodevorgang, bei dem status gemeldet wird.
Anforderungen
Anforderung | Wert |
---|---|
Unterstützte Mindestversion (Client) | Verfügbar in Windows 10, Version 1709 und höher von Windows. |
Kopfzeile | scsi.h (einschließlich Minitape.h, Storport.h) |